Output 86638834b752dbc0cc04874f26cfc39b0a60fe2471050e45049bb09842a4721a:6

value
254627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3321338627d451094f4772e99b43f075261edd06 OP_EQUALVERIFY OP_CHECKSIG
address
15fMEea17UAd1v3Yhg1o2kx1LgZejZW7z2
transaction
86638834b752dbc0cc04874f26cfc39b0a60fe2471050e45049bb09842a4721a
spent
true